| Lisa Greco
Studio Director / Lisa has been performing since she was a child. At age 16 she choreographed her first piece. She went on to graduate with a BA in dance and music from Hunter College. While in college she managed the dance company, taught dance club once a week, performed her own choreography throughout NYC, and went on to graduate with honors in dance.After college she continued to perform and choreograph her own work on the modern dance scene. Lisa has benn honored to have studied with both Martha Graham and Merce Cunningham and many other pioneers in the modern dance world. .She also is an accomplished drummer. She has played the drums in many venues throughout NYC. Her choreography can also be seen in her music videos. Lisa is a liscenced massage therapist and has an extensive background in anatomy and kiniesiology. Lisa has taught dance in both the NYC and Westchester school systems and looks forward to running her own dance center JUMP!
Caren Valente
has been teaching, choreographing and performing in and around Westchester since graduating from Marymount Manhattan College with her BA in Dance. She is on faculty at Purchase College where she teaches Dance Fitness and is the coach of the Dance Team. Caren is also on faculty at the Steffi Nossen School of Dance where she teaches modern and jazz techniques. She has choreographed musicals for Scarsdale High School, White Plains Middle School, Purchase Youth Theater and the Playgroup Theater. As a performer Caren has danced with Kinetic Dance Theater, appeared as a dancer on the AMC Series "Into Character: Dirty Dancing", and danced in the Off- Broadway Musical "Still on the Corner."
Cynthia S. D’Angelo a native of Pittsfield , MA , began her training with Judi Drozd of the Joffrey Ballet. She joined the Albany Berkshire Ballet junior company at 14 years of age. Upon graduating from high school, she joined ABB as a full company member, where she was a soloist and danced ballets such as Giselle, Cinderella, a Midsummer Night’s Dream & the Nutcracker. Ms. D’Angelo studied at the Boston Ballet, Jacob’s Pillow Dance Festival with touring in Russia , and the Walnut Hill School of Performing Arts before deciding to attend the University of Missouri– K.C.- where she was an adjunct professor of Dance. She went on to dance for the Wylliams/Henry Danse Theatre and serve as Company Administrator. Currently Ms. D’Angelo resides in NY teaching and choreographing in Westchester County .
Marissa Kretzmer
A Bronx , NY native, began her training with Barbra Walczak of the New York City Ballet. She is a graduate of the H.S. of Performing Arts. Marissa continued her studies on scholarship at: STEPS on Broadway, the Alvin Ailey American Dance Center and the University of Akron . Ms. Kretzmer has been dancing professionally since 1989 and has danced with: the Wylliams/Henry Danse Theatre, Albany Berkshire Ballet, Once Upon A Time, Inc., and the Ballet Theatre of Westchester. Currently, she enjoys teaching and child advocacy in NY
Kate Sedlack
Kate Sedlack has been dancing and loving it since the mere age of three. She began her training at Robin Horneff's Performing Arts Center, where she was a company member until graduating high school. She then went on to receive her BFA in Dance Choreography from Arizona State University. She currently is on staff at Bronx Preparatory Charter School in the South Bronx, where she teaches dance to students in the 5th-12th grades. Kate resides in Manhattan and is a member of The Movement Collective Dance Company. She recently had the opportunity to dance as a guest dancer with Naganuma Dance. Her work can be seen at Teatro La Tea. Kate's love of dance is apparent in her energetic teaching approach and technically challenging movement.
